Skipping Proper Planning and Research
The second greatest pitfall of app development is getting your wires crossed in terms of not planning enough before getting down to coding. Lacking specific goals, market research, and opposition studies, the app is at risk of becoming a non-solving product. Necessary research also sets the features and design of the apps, thus assisting the developers in developing the correct product in the first place.
Neglecting User Experience (UX)
It is imperative to concentrate on the look and not the interaction. Slow or confusing interface will result in user abandonment. The ease of use, quick page loading, and attractive design should be the primary focus to make customers feel and stay satisfied.
Underestimating Testing Importance
Testing as little or as nothing as possible leads to bugs and crashes once launched. Detailed testing which involves functional, usability, and performance tests is required to build a reliable application. Testing in the initial stages and frequently will avoid expensive corrections in the future and this will also enhance user confidence.
Poor Communication Between Teams
There are misunderstanding and delays because the developers, designers, and stakeholders fail to communicate clearly. Agile styles and constant agile updates ensure that everyone is on track hence one can make changes in good time and development is not painful.
Overcomplicating the App
The attempt to add as many features as possible at once confuses the users and development in general. Start with a Minimum Viable Product (MVP) that focuses on core features. This will reduce the time needed to launch in the market and will also provide worthwhile feedback by the users to help in preparing future updates.
Ignoring Post-Launch Support
App development doesn’t end at launch. The lack of attention to the updates, bug improvements, and user feedback makes this app obsolete and pushes users away. Continuous maintenance and improvement are crucial to long-term success.
